One significant downside, in addition to AO functionality, to trying to continue using the Jupiter units is changes to the hidden stat that determines move order.

Harpoon Grenadiers (SAJM ranged) have equal initiative to Overclock Orbiters (SAT artillery) - i've been using mass overclock orbiters to take them out in small numbers in SAJM GBG quite cleanly. Pressurizers (SAT ranged) have higher initiative (and thus always move before the artillery and do significant damage - noted from PvP arena bots). But as long as there's no artillery, contact + rogue advantage is likely to make grenadiers still a valuable tool.

Permafrost Drones (SAT fast) also have higher initiative than Abyssal Gliders (SAJM fast) - and thus any 8 abyssal glider comps will take initial hits from any permafrost drones on defense. 8 Abyssal Gliders may be better than 8 Permafrost Drones against a defending army with no Permafrost Drones though - but there's generally a better attack against such an army: Overclock Orbiters (SAT Artillery).

That said, that doesn't mean their SAT counterparts are great - the reduced range of the fast and the no-contact on the ranged does make them less powerful than the SAJM experience.

The powerful unit this time is the Overclock Orbiter - but it has a strong counter (flying Permafrost Drones) and a weak counter (ranged Pressurizer that moves before the orbiters and can often hit them first) so you can't use it all the time.

---

If you're insist on fast autobattling it seems likely that defense for attacking army will be more important than ever in this age as you'll want to minimize the damage taken by units that all have downsides that make them less than perfect. Permafrost Drones are probably the most general unit - and if coupled with good defense (read: at least 50% higher than your attack, if not more) are usable against everything. Without good defense, you're probably going to be taking a lot more losses due to their imperfections.

But this is also an age that rewards changing your army depending on the composition of the defense. Fitting in Overclock Orbiters wherever they work well enough will push your attrition way higher than resting on one solid army.

You're phrasing tech tree costs a lot more maliciously than they really are lol. Could you even propose a solution to this 'problem'?
It'd be straightforward enough to "fix" - often the shortages are caused by back to back techs demanding the same good repeatedly coupled with story rewards that are mostly for the other goods. Distribute things out more evenly or provide story rewards that are heavier on the goods in demand early and the experience wouldn't happen.

But I think they believe that having goods go through phases of scarcity makes for a more interesting experience on release of a new age. I think I agree to some extent - though I'm not sure how important it really is.

Tell me about it! I really miss the early "good for credits" house from other space ages this era. This era only has the 3 houses: the initial bad-at-everything house. the best-at-population house. and the very deep in the tree "you probably don't worry about credits anymore but this one is very good at it" house.
